THE 2024 SEASON COMES TO AN END!!!

McLaren clinch up their 9th Constructor's World Championship after 26 years, first one to add to the closet after 1998,a well deserved one which now ties them with Williams for second place on number of constructor's championship since inception of F1. They won the championship via a dominating win by Lando Norris who was in the lead of the race from start to end and looked like the clear winner through and through. The last championship won by McLaren was before Oscar and Lando had even been born.

At the start of the race, Oscar was tagged on the rear by Max when he made an opportunistic move on him to get into P2 but it did not pan out the way it did putting Oscar right at the back of the field and Max also way down. This put the Constructor's title also a big task to get from an easy smooth sailing one as now all the pressure was laid on Lando and he sure as hell delivered with a supreme, dominating win.

Ferrari gave it their all with Charles going from P19 to P8 on lap one . Also Carlos was promoted to P2 due to the Oscar-Max collision and after a few laps and some awesome overtakes Charles was up to P3, it was at this point that the Constructor's looked possible for Ferrari only if they could overtake Lando or if McLaren made a mistake or even a Safety car would have worked in their favour. But all this was in vain, even after a supreme drive by both Scuderia drivers to finish P2 and P3, at the end as Lando  held on to the lead. A sad ending for Ferrari even though this is their highest ever points total as they missed out on the constructors by only 14 points. It was even more sad for their drivers,  with Carlos parting with the team making this his final race, in which both Charles and Carlos wanted to end their driver pairing at a high with the Constructor's world championship, but alas that did not happen.

Red Bull even though they won the Driver's Championship, but finished 3rd in the Constructor's due to the lack of pace shown by Sergio Perez  all throughout the season. In the end finished he finished a whopping 285 points behind Max, disastrous to say the least. He finished P8 in the driver's championship, even behind both the Mercedes drivers by a big margin which speaks volumes. At last let's talk about Mercedes and Hamilton. 

It was their last race together. An end to the 12 seasons in which they won 6 driver's championships, 8 consecutive team constructor titles, 84 wins, 78 pole positions and 153 podiummssss!!!! 

It started out as a leap of faith but turned a journey into the history books

as stated by Hamilton and rightfully so as this is the most successful driver team pairing ever in the history of F1.
